Solution Architects perform the eChain Design activities, and are focused on solving business needs in an innovative and strategic manner. Decisions are evaluated against how they will allow the enterprise or a single software system to grow and perform in the long term. Great care is taken to create and identify opportunities for re-use. Budget, time to market, scalability and reuse are key decision factors in selecting the appropriate solution design from many alternatives

Business Needs Assessment (BNA) is a methodical, detailed analysis (BR0) and documentation of your companies business project requirements, business rules, scope, workflows, actors, use cases, process maps, etc., needed to gain consensus on the common vision of the business needs. The BNA is a critical step in successfully identifying and developing solutions that meet the business needs.
